You will be responsible for the development and modification of safety-critical documentation. This will include technical content including, but not limited to, engineering and safety procedures, maintenance instructions, and associated technical content, as well as operational and training documentation. In this role, you work with a passionate team about all facets of Performance Alignment including documentation, training, assessment, and auditing for safety-critical processes.
You will report to Manager-Technical Publications
This is a Project Hire/Temporary Assignment (TA) with no guarantee of permanent placement with an estimated end date of 10/23/2027.
What You Will DoModel safe behaviors at all times, and encourage team members, peers, and partners to do the same.
Participate and assist in the review of applicable standards and industry guidelines.
Develop new content or modify existing content, based on input from quality engineering, facilities engineering, and safety services.
Translate subject matter information into formalized procedures in a standardized format. Ensure appropriate configuration management and version control for all documentation.
Ensure all appropriate documentation reviews and approvals are acquired and documented.
Verify all documentation meets compliance requirements.
Use applicable software programs to create and distribute documentation to user groups.
Communicate progress and provide regular updates to leader.
After the project, ensure that all documentation results are set up in appropriate systems and sustainment guidelines are updated and available.
